Book Summary

The Art Of Shaping Lives: Mastering Your Own Destiny Invites You To Explore How Deeds, Character, And Destiny Are Formed By Thought, Effort, And Purpose. This Non-Fiction Guide To Personal Growth Speaks To Adults And Curious Readers Who Want A Steadier, More Meaningful Life. The Tone Is Thoughtful, Encouraging, And Inspiringโ€”Grounded And Practicalโ€”Designed To Help You Unlock Your Potential.

James Allen (November 28, 1864โ€“January 24, 1912) Was A Pioneer In The Field Of Motivational Literature. He Was Highly Regarded For His Ability To Combine Philosophy And Inspiration To Provide Solutions To Everyday Problems. His Writings Were Deeply Philosophical But Also Filled With Positive Energy. These Four Pieces Of Writing Are Considered Gems That Have The Power To Enrich The Mind. James Allen Was A British Philosophical Writer And A Pioneer Of The Self-Help Movement. He Was Born To A Working-Class Family In Leicester, England And Worked As A Private Secretary And Stationer In Several Manufacturing Firms Before He Turned To A Life Of Writing. He Initially Worked As A Journalist, Before He Found His True Calling As A Spiritual And Social Writer For The Herald Of The Golden Age Magazine. In 1902, He Began Publishing His Own Spiritual Magazine, The Epoch. Allen Was A Fruitful Writer; He Wrote Motivational Books About Self-Growth, Penning A Total Of Nineteen Works In His Lifetime. As A Man Thinketh Is His Third And Most Famous Book That Continues To Inspire Readers Around The World.
